Describe the bug
After doing a lookup, the 2nd group always shows up as empty. If you go to the next definition (either by clicking the Next arrow or scrolling with the mouse wheel), then definitions appear again (starting from 2nd definition)
To Reproduce
Steps to reproduce the behavior:
Enable 2nd dictionary group in settings
Look up a word
Notice the 2nd group is empty. If you were to create a card now, the 2nd definition will be left blank!
Go to next definition in 2nd group
Notice that 2nd group has a definition now
Go to previous group and notice 1st definition is now available and visible
Expected behavior
2nd definition should be visible immediately after lookup
